Transaction c4133c856b7294075e8571d78d6f836fc094f3c29bab45f0a1aa3781bcc85efe

block
363366fc4a2932608ddbb3164e05e7cff2e47d215e1a210553a834cd8148dae7

1 Input

23 Outputs